Heim > Artikel > Backend-Entwicklung > Wie sollten die Produkttabelle und die Produktattribute für ein Einkaufszentrum besser gestaltet werden?
Mein Produkt ist beispielsweise ein iPhone 6s-Mobiltelefon, das in den Farben Champagner, Silber und Grau erhältlich ist, darunter 16G, 32G und 64G.
Was ist Ihrer Meinung nach die Produkt-ID der Farbversion = ein Produkt? Auf diese Weise verfügt ein Produkt über mehrere Produkte. Sie teilen die Produkteinführungsdetails usw. Was nicht geteilt wird, ist das Produktalbum, die Einführung und dergleichen.
Ist es besser, das oben Gesagte zu tun oder alle Farbversionen als eine Produkt-ID zu behandeln?
Mein Produkt ist beispielsweise ein iPhone 6s-Mobiltelefon, das in den Farben Champagner, Silber und Grau erhältlich ist, darunter 16G, 32G und 64G.
Was ist Ihrer Meinung nach die Produkt-ID der Farbversion = ein Produkt? Auf diese Weise verfügt ein Produkt über mehrere Produkte. Sie teilen die Produkteinführungsdetails usw. Was nicht geteilt wird, ist das Produktalbum, die Einführung und dergleichen.
Ist es besser, das oben Gesagte zu tun oder alle Farbversionen als eine Produkt-ID zu behandeln?
Farbe und Kapazität sind gleich. Es ist einfach eine Eigenschaft des Produkts.
Produkttabelle und Produktattributtabelle sollten ausreichen.
Die Produktattributtabelle enthält Attributnamen (z. B. Farbe) und Attributwerte (schwarz).
Die Produktliste ist einfach. Einige inhärente Attribute wie Inventar, Preis usw.
Trennen Sie die beiden Tabellen. Eine 6S entspricht mehreren Attributen. Wenn wir die anderen Geschwindigkeiten und dergleichen nicht trennen, wird es zunächst zu chaotisch. Für das Produktalbum können Sie zur Vereinfachung eine separate Anhangstabelle erstellen Management
Finden Sie einfach SPU und SKU heraus